Requirements

  • Master’s degree (MPH or equivalent) required; Doctorate level (MD, OD, PharmD, PhD) preferred.
  • Minimum of 3 years of clinical or therapeutic experience in ophthalmology, retina diseases, and/or gene therapy.
  • Experience in field-based scientific exchange and/or clinical trial support.
  • Superior communication, relationship building, and interpersonal skills.
  • Ability to assimilate new clinical data quickly.
  • Proactive problem-solving, project management, and medical writing skills.
  • Ability to organize and lead high-level projects.
  • Ability to work collaboratively with cross-functional teams.
  • Ability to travel 50-70% of the time.

Responsibilities

  • Support clinical trial recruitment and site outreach while communicating feedback to internal teams.
  • Serve as the field-based Medical Affairs representative to cultivate scientific relationships with KOLs.
  • Develop and execute a customer-centric tactical engagement plan.
  • Gather and share scientific insights to inform medical strategies.
  • Address unsolicited medical questions regarding trials and investigational products.
  • Provide clinical expertise for the development of educational materials and meeting presentations.
  • Represent Medical Affairs at medical conferences and assist with strategy and competitive intelligence.
  • Support patient advocacy conferences and outreach.
